Contoh Aktivitas Menampilkan Bilangan Prima 1-100 Di Java

Pada artikel berguru java kali ini, kita akan menciptakan teladan aktivitas menampilkan bilangan prima 1 hingga 100, memakai bahasa pemrograman Java. Seperti yang kita tahu , dalam bahan pelajaran matematika yang kita jumpai ketika di sekolah. Bilangan orisinil yang lebih besar dari 1 , dan juga yang merupakan faktor pembaginya 1 atau bilangan itu sendiri termasuk ke dalam bilangan prima. Jika kita gunakan cara manual , untuk menghitung atau memilih bilangan prima kita dapat menambahkan angka 6 dari angka 5 dan 7. Jika bilangan akan habis di bagi 5 dan 7 , maka bilangan tersebut bukan termasuk bilangan prima. Nah,  bagaimana kalau kita coba terapkan di dalam aktivitas Java. Berikut selengkapnya mari kita simak.

 kita akan menciptakan teladan aktivitas menampilkan bilangan prima  Contoh Program Menampilkan Bilangan Prima 1-100 di Java

1. Pertama buka IntelliJ IDEA ,atau Software IDE lain yang kalian gunakan , di Komputer atau Laptop kalian.
2.  Kalian dapat perhatikan Contoh code ,beserta penjelasanya di bawah:

Contoh Code:

 kita akan menciptakan teladan aktivitas menampilkan bilangan prima  Contoh Program Menampilkan Bilangan Prima 1-100 di Java
Contoh Code Bilangan Prima 1-100

Penjelasan :

Pada  baris code pertama ,kita menginisialisasi variable index , angka , dan bilanganPrima.

Selanjutnya , disini kita akan gunakan ,nested looping , yang dimana looping for di bab dalam (inner) , di sanksi terlebih dahulu. Setelah itu gres looping for di bab luar (outer).
Lalu, kita akan gunakan looping for  bagian luar (outer) ,yang menampilkan index  , secara berulang, dari 1 hingga 100, dan juga kita  inisialisasi variable counter , secara default nilainya 0.  Kaprikornus disini kita akan mencari bilangan prima dari range 1 hingga 100.
Di dalam looping for bab dalam (inner) , kita akan samakan nilai dari index sama dengan angka. Kondisi kalau nilai dari var angka lebih dari atau sama dengan 1 , maka nilainya akan berkurang 1. Kaprikornus di dalam looping for bab dalam (inner) ini  , akan berfungsi untuk  tidak menampilkan (hilang dari output) yang bukan termasuk bilangan prima. 
Di dalamnya  lagi , kita gunakan kondisi if , yang dimana kalau nilai dari index dan angka habis di bagi , atau sisa baginya = 0. Maka nilai dari variable counter akan bertambah 1. Sebaliknya , kalau nilai dari index dan angka , tidak habis di bagi. Maka bilangan tersebut termasuk bilangan prima. Nilai dari  variable counter akan tetap = 0.
Contoh misal , kita menampilkan bilangan prima dari range 1 hingga 10. Maka output akhirnya , akan menampilkan : 2, 3 ,5, 7.  Sisanya berarti yang bukan termasuk bilangan prima : 4 , 6,8,9,10. Kenapa bukan termasuk bilangan prima ?  Karena 4 , akan habis di bagi dengan 2 , 6 akan habis dibagi dengan 3 atau 2 , 8 akan habis di bagi dengan 4 atau 2 ,9 akan habis di bagi 3, dan 10 akan habis dibagi dengan 5 atau 2.  
Begitu juga seterusnya  hingga range 100 ,seperti teladan code aktivitas diatas.
Jika kalian belum paham ,tentang pembagian dan sisa bagi kalian dapat baca artikel sebelumnya :
Selanjutnya , bilangan prima akan di awali dengan angka 2 , ibarat pada code kondisi if counter == 2.
Lalu , hasil dari nilai bilangan prima akan di simpan ke variable  bilanganPrima. Jadi setiap bilangan  prima ,yang dimana tidak akan habis di bagi , akan ditampilkan pada output hasil.
Setelah itu , tampilkan output hasilnya.
Output :
 kita akan menciptakan teladan aktivitas menampilkan bilangan prima  Contoh Program Menampilkan Bilangan Prima 1-100 di Java
Output Hasil


Sumber https://www.okedroid.com/

Loading...